科威特比特币钱包概述 在数字经济和加密货币时代,比特币作为一种主要的数字资产,逐渐被全球范围内的用户所接...
以太坊(Ethereum)作为目前使用最广泛的区块链平台之一,其钱包的同步问题常常困扰着许多用户。通过通过以太坊钱包,用户可以管理其以太币(ETH)及其他基于以太坊平台的代币。钱包的同步是其正常运作的基础,但有时用户会遇到同步不完整或停滞的问题。本文将深入探讨以太坊钱包的同步机制,导致同步问题的原因,以及一些可行的解决方案,并对相关疑问进行详细解答。
在讨论同步问题之前,理解以太坊钱包的基本原理是十分重要的。以太坊网络是去中心化的,没有中央机构来管理数据和交易。每个用户通过“节点”参与网络,节点之间共享彼此的数据。
以太坊钱包实际上是指一种能够与以太坊区块链交互的客户端软件。它可以是全节点钱包,如Geth或Parity,也可以是轻量级钱包,如MetaMask。全节点钱包下载整个区块链,提供了完整的安全性和功能。而轻量级钱包则依赖全节点提供的服务,只需要下载部分数据即可工作。
在使用以太坊钱包时,用户需要确保他们的钱包与以太坊区块链保持同步。每当新的区块被添加到区块链中,钱包就需要下载并验证这些信息,以确保用户的资产和交易都是最新的。
同步的过程可以分为以下几个步骤:
接下来,我们就要探讨可能导致以太坊钱包同步不完整的原因。以下是一些常见的因素:
根据上述原因,用户可以尝试以下几种解决方案,以修复以太坊钱包同步不完整的
以太坊钱包同步所需时间因节点类型、网络连接、计算机性能等因素而异。一旦选择全节点,用户需要下载整个区块链,因此通常需要几天甚至几周的时间,尤其是在网络繁忙时。若使用轻量级钱包,同步时间会显著更短,因为它只下载部分数据,与全节点相比,启动更快,通常几分钟到几小时内即可完成。
此外,用户还可以根据选择的同步方式(完整同步、快速同步或轻量级同步)来影响同步时间。快速同步会在验证过程中优先获取后来的数据,从而加速同步;而轻量级同步只需要下载并验证必要的信息,省去了冗长的过程。
在同步过程中,可能出现多个错误,主要是在下载和验证过程中遇到的问题。例如,数据丢失或链接中断可能会导致错误。其他常见原因还包括由于区块链分叉而导致不同链之间的数据冲突。某些情况下,软件本身的缺陷或版本不兼容也会引发同步错误。这种情况下,用户需要查看错误日志或错误代码,根据指引处理相应问题。
在出现错误时,有几种处理方式。一是重新启动钱包,并尝试重新同步;二是下载最新版本的钱包客户端,确保没有软件相关的Bug;三是更换使用的节点,尝试连接到运行正常的节点。
选择适合的以太坊钱包需要考虑多个因素,包括用户的需求、安全性、易用性和支持的功能。总体而言,可以将以太坊钱包分为三种:全节点钱包、轻量级钱包和硬件钱包。
全节点钱包提供最佳安全性和保护,因为它们存储整个区块链数据。然而,这类钱包通常要求较高的硬件配置和存储空间;轻量级钱包对于大部分用户更加友好,它存储数据量较少,更适合普通使用者,启动方便;硬件钱包则是最安全的选择,适合持有大额资产的用户,可以离线存储私钥,降低风险。
综上所述,用户在选择钱包时应综合考虑自己的使用场景及对安全性的需求。
是的,以太坊钱包在同步后仍需定期更新。以太坊区块链是一个动态变化的环境,新的交易和区块会不断增加。此外,钱包客户端本身也会不断更新,以修复bug、提升功能以及增加新的特性。用户应定期检查钱包的版本更新,并及时更新到最新版本,以确保获取最新的安全保护和性能。
在更新时,需要备份现有的钱包数据,以防数据丢失。大多数钱包客户端都会提供备份选项,用户可以导出私钥或助记词以确保数据的安全。
通过本文对以太坊钱包同步问题的详细介绍,我们希望能够帮助用户更好地理解和解决以太坊钱包同步不完整的问题,让用户在使用以太坊进行交易和管理资产时更加顺利。